.margin15 {margin:15px 0px;}
.grey {color:#8B8B8B;}
.mov {color:#9584D9;}
.winners {font-size:16px; margin-bottom:5px;}
.hr {background:url(../../../img/contest/single_question/hr_line.gif) repeat-x top; width:666px; height:2px; font-size:1px;}
.top_contest {margin:0px 0px 25px 0px;}
.top_description {margin:0px 0px 25px 0px;}
.top_description .img_left {float:left; border:3px solid #E8E1FE; margin:0px 10px 0px 0px;}
.top_description h1 {font:26px normal Arial, Helvetica, sans-serif;color:#000000;}
.top_description h2 {font:22px normal Arial, Helvetica, sans-serif;color:#000000; margin: 5px 0 10px; }

ul.lista_castigatori {font:12px normal Arial, Helvetica, sans-serif; color:#000000;}
ul.lista_castigatori li {margin-bottom:5px;}
.page-nav-contest {}
.page-nav-contest .page_nav_active {color:#8B8B8B;}
.page-nav-contest a.page_nav_link {color:#9584D9; font-weight:bold;}
.page-nav-contest a.page_nav_arrows {color:#9584D9; font-weight:bold;}
.small_description {margin-bottom:20px;}
.small_description span.name {font-weight:bold; font-size:14px;}
.pool_contest {width:666px; background-color:#F3F0FE; font:14px normal Arial, Helvetica, sans-serif; color:#000000; margin-bottom:20px;}
.pool_contest .content {padding:12px;}
.c1 {margin-bottom:15px;}
.check_terms {padding:0px 0px 0px 12px; margin:0px 0px 20px 0px; color:#000000; font-size:14px;}
.check_terms span a {color:#990000; text-decoration:underline;}
#frm_container {margin-bottom:15px;}
#terms_container { margin: 0 0 20px 15px; }
.btm_contest {background:url(../../../img/contest/single_question/btm_page_contest.jpg) no-repeat top; width:666px; height:58px;}
.btm_contest .btn_participa {padding:10px 0px 0px 280px; float:left;}
.btm_contest .castigatori {float:right; display:inline; margin-right:10px; padding:27px 0px 0px 0px;}
.btm_contest .castigatori a {font-size:11px; font-weight:bold; color:#666666; text-decoration:underline;}
.content_contest {padding:0px 0px 0px 12px;}

/*****index****/
.concurs_evidentiat {margin-bottom:15px;}

.lista_concursuri {}
.lista_concursuri li a img {border:3px solid #E8E1FE; margin-bottom:7px;}
.lista_concursuri li.last {margin-right:0px;}
.lista_concursuri div.opacity {position:relative;}
.lista_concursuri div.opacity  img {opacity: 0.35; -moz-opacity: 0.35; filter:alpha(opacity=35);  border:3px solid #E8E1FE;}
.lista_concursuri div.opacity .closed {right:3px; top:3px; position:absolute; background:url(../../../img/contest/single_question/inchis.gif) no-repeat top right;width:58px; height:58px;}
.lista_concursuri li {float:left; width:141px; margin:0px 25px 20px 0px; height:227px; overflow:hidden;}
.lista_concursuri li img {border:3px solid #E8E1FE; display:block;}
.lista_concursuri li .poza {margin-bottom:5px;}
.lista_concursuri li .descriere {margin-bottom:5px}
.lista_concursuri li a {font-weight:bold; font-size:11px;}
.lista_concursuri .evidentiat {width:315px;}



.bg_participat {background:url(../../../img/contest/single_question/bg_participat.jpg) no-repeat top; width:666px; height:187px;}
.bg_succes {background:url(../../../img/contest/single_question/bg_succes.jpg) no-repeat top; width:666px; height:212px;}

.alert .content {padding:47px 0px 0px 170px}
.alert .msg_ok {font:18px bold Arial, Helvetica, sans-serif; color:#000; margin-bottom:10px;}
.alert .msg_error {font:18px bold Arial, Helvetica, sans-serif; color:#cc3300; margin-bottom:10px;}
.alert .msg1 {color:#000;}
.alert a {font-weight:bold; text-decoration:underline; color:#000;}
.default_link {color:#9584D9; font-weight:bold;}
.frm_opacity { opacity: 0.85; -moz-opacity: 0.85; filter:alpha(opacity=85);  background: #ffffff; top:0; left:0;  position:absolute; z-index:100;  }
.frm_error { position:absolute;  display:block; top:0; left:0; color:#000000; text-align:center; z-index:200; }
.frm_error h1 {font:24px normal Arial, Helvetica, sans-serif;color:#000000; }








